Pomegranate Artbooks of San Francisco – and Maldon, Essex – has come up with Essential Einstein ($22.95, ISBN 0 87654 472 3), a collection of 60 duo-tone photographs of the man himself. Interspersed with quotes, introduced by an essay by Alan Bisbort, compiled and edited by Allen Boyce Eddington, it’s a fascinating record of Einstein from his middle to old age. And, yes, the leather jacket pic is included.
